How to create a MySQL database

To create a MySQL database, you need to use the following steps:

1. Connect to the MySQL server

Use a MySQL client tool (such as MySQL Workbench or command line) to connect to the MySQL server. Log in using your username and password.

2. Create a database

Use the CREATE DATABASE statement to create a database. Database names must start with a letter and can contain up to 64 letters, numbers, underscores, or dollar signs.

CREATE DATABASE [数据库名称];

3. Select the database

Use the USE statement to select the newly created database. This sets it as the current working database and allows you to perform operations on it.

USE [数据库名称];

4. Create a table

Use the CREATE TABLE statement to create a table in the database. A table is a structured container for storing data, containing multiple columns, each column storing a specific type of data.

CREATE TABLE [表名称] (
  [列名称1] [数据类型1],
  [列名称2] [数据类型2],
  ...
  [列名称N] [数据类型N]
);

5. Insert data

Use the INSERT statement to insert data into the table. The data value must match the column's data type.

INSERT INTO [表名称] (
  [列名称1],
  [列名称2],
  ...
  [列名称N]
) VALUES (
  [值1],
  [值2],
  ...
  [值N]
);

6. Query data

Use the SELECT statement to query the data in the database. You can filter, sort, and limit the set of results returned.

SELECT * FROM [表名称]
WHERE [条件];

MySQL vs. Other Databases: Comparing the Options MySQL vs. Other Databases: Comparing the Options Apr 15, 2025 am 12:08 AM

MySQL is suitable for web applications and content management systems and is popular for its open source, high performance and ease of use. 1) Compared with PostgreSQL, MySQL performs better in simple queries and high concurrent read operations. 2) Compared with Oracle, MySQL is more popular among small and medium-sized enterprises because of its open source and low cost. 3) Compared with Microsoft SQL Server, MySQL is more suitable for cross-platform applications. 4) Unlike MongoDB, MySQL is more suitable for structured data and transaction processing.
